Manchester United midfielder Jesse Lingard was happy for Anthony Martial after his five-star performance in their draw Real Madrid.
Moments before half-time, Lingard was perfectly placed to finish off a move in which Martial took on four or five defenders on the left-hand byline before selflessly cutting the ball back.
"It was great," acknowledged the scorer in his pitchside MUTV interview. "Anthony's got great feet when it comes to close control and he's got the confidence to do it in a game. It's a nightmare for defenders. Luckily I've got myself into space at the back post, got away from my man and then put it away."
United won the International Champions Cup tie on penalties.
Lingard also said of Martials performance: "He's only going to get better.
"He's still young and if he carries on with that confidence [he showed for the goal] in the next few games and throughout the season, he'll help us a lot."
